메뉴 건너뛰기




Volumn 2015-January, Issue , 2015, Pages 267-281

A probabilistic graphical model-based approach for minimizing energy under performance constraints

Author keywords

Adaptation; Dynamic systems; Energy minimization; Probabilistic graphical models; Statistics

Indexed keywords

COMMERCE; DYNAMICAL SYSTEMS; ENERGY CONSERVATION; GRAPHIC METHODS; HEURISTIC METHODS; OBJECT ORIENTED PROGRAMMING; ORBITS; PARETO PRINCIPLE; STATISTICS;

EID: 84939133793     PISSN: None     EISSN: None     Source Type: Conference Proceeding    
DOI: 10.1145/2694344.2694373     Document Type: Conference Paper
Times cited : (31)

References (62)
  • 2
    • 79957514447 scopus 로고    scopus 로고
    • Language and compiler support for auto-tuning variable-accuracy algorithms
    • Jason Ansel, Yee Lok Wong, Cy Chan, Marek Olszewski, Alan Edelman, and Saman Amarasinghe. Language and compiler support for auto-tuning variable-accuracy algorithms. In CGO, 2011.
    • (2011) CGO
    • Ansel, J.1    Wong, Y.L.2    Chan, C.3    Olszewski, M.4    Edelman, A.5    Amarasinghe, S.6
  • 3
    • 47249127725 scopus 로고    scopus 로고
    • The case for energy-proportional computing
    • Dec
    • L.A Barroso and U. Holzle. The case for energy-proportional computing. Computer, 40(12):33-37, Dec 2007.
    • (2007) Computer , vol.40 , Issue.12 , pp. 33-37
    • Barroso, L.A.1    Holzle, U.2
  • 4
    • 63549095070 scopus 로고    scopus 로고
    • The PARSEC benchmark suite: Characterization and architectural implications
    • C. Bienia, S. Kumar, J. P. Singh, and K. Li. The PARSEC benchmark suite: Characterization and architectural implications. In PACT, 2008.
    • (2008) PACT
    • Bienia, C.1    Kumar, S.2    Singh, J.P.3    Li, K.4
  • 5
    • 66749161432 scopus 로고    scopus 로고
    • Coordinated management of multiple interacting resources in chip multiprocessors: A machine learning approach
    • Ramazan Bitirgen, Engin Ipek, and Jose F. Martinez. Coordinated management of multiple interacting resources in chip multiprocessors: A machine learning approach. In MICRO, 2008.
    • (2008) MICRO
    • Bitirgen, R.1    Ipek, E.2    Martinez, J.F.3
  • 9
    • 79959587779 scopus 로고    scopus 로고
    • Predictive coordination of multiple on-chip resources for chip multiprocessors
    • Jian Chen and Lizy Kurian John. Predictive coordination of multiple on-chip resources for chip multiprocessors. In ICS, 2011.
    • (2011) ICS
    • Chen, J.1    John, L.K.2
  • 10
    • 79960159141 scopus 로고    scopus 로고
    • Modeling program resource demand using inherent program characteristics
    • June
    • Jian Chen, Lizy Kurian John, and Dimitris Kaseridis. Modeling program resource demand using inherent program characteristics. SIGMETRICS Perform. Eval. Rev., 39(1):1-12, June 2011.
    • (2011) SIGMETRICS Perform. Eval. Rev. , vol.39 , Issue.1 , pp. 1-12
    • Chen, J.1    John, L.K.2    Kaseridis, D.3
  • 11
    • 84858763476 scopus 로고    scopus 로고
    • Pack & cap: Adaptive dvfs and thread packing under power caps
    • Ryan Cochran, Can Hankendi, Ayse K. Coskun, and Sherief Reda. Pack & cap: adaptive dvfs and thread packing under power caps. In MICRO, 2011.
    • (2011) MICRO
    • Cochran, R.1    Hankendi, C.2    Coskun, A.K.3    Reda, S.4
  • 12
    • 84876526315 scopus 로고    scopus 로고
    • Coscale: Coordinating cpu and memory system dvfs in server systems
    • 2012 45th Annual IEEE/ACM International Symposium on IEEE
    • Qingyuan Deng, David Meisner, Abhishek Bhattacharjee, Thomas F Wenisch, and Ricardo Bianchini. Coscale: Coordinating cpu and memory system dvfs in server systems. In Microarchitecture (MICRO), 2012 45th Annual IEEE/ACM International Symposium on, pages 143-154. IEEE, 2012.
    • (2012) Microarchitecture (MICRO) , pp. 143-154
    • Deng, Q.1    Meisner, D.2    Bhattacharjee, A.3    Wenisch, T.F.4    Bianchini, R.5
  • 14
    • 79951697270 scopus 로고    scopus 로고
    • A predictive model for dynamic microarchitectural adaptivity control
    • Christophe Dubach, Timothy M. Jones, Edwin V. Bonilla, and Michael F. P. O'Boyle. A predictive model for dynamic microarchitectural adaptivity control. In MICRO, 2010.
    • (2010) MICRO
    • Dubach, C.1    Jones, T.M.2    Bonilla, E.V.3    O'Boyle, M.F.P.4
  • 15
    • 84949161141 scopus 로고
    • Data analysis using Stein's estimator and its generalizations
    • Bradley Efron and Carl Morris. Data analysis using stein's estimator and its generalizations. Journal of the American Statistical Association, 70(350):311-319, 1975.
    • (1975) Journal of the American Statistical Association , vol.70 , Issue.350 , pp. 311-319
    • Efron, B.1    Morris, C.2
  • 16
    • 84994156481 scopus 로고    scopus 로고
    • Automated design of self-adaptive software with control-theoretical formal guarantees
    • Antonio Filieri, Henry Hoffmann, and Martina Maggio. Automated design of self-adaptive software with control-theoretical formal guarantees. In ICSE, 2014.
    • (2014) ICSE
    • Filieri, A.1    Hoffmann, H.2    Maggio, M.3
  • 17
    • 85013986282 scopus 로고    scopus 로고
    • Energy-aware adaptation for mobile applications
    • J. Flinn and M. Satyanarayanan. Energy-aware adaptation for mobile applications. In SOSP, 1999.
    • (1999) SOSP
    • Flinn, J.1    Satyanarayanan, M.2
  • 18
    • 2542487475 scopus 로고    scopus 로고
    • Managing battery lifetime with energy-aware adaptation
    • May
    • Jason Flinn and M. Satyanarayanan. Managing battery lifetime with energy-aware adaptation. ACM Trans. Comp. Syst., 22(2), May 2004.
    • (2004) ACM Trans. Comp. Syst. , vol.22 , Issue.2
    • Flinn, J.1    Satyanarayanan, M.2
  • 21
    • 84889653189 scopus 로고    scopus 로고
    • Racing vs. Pacing to idle: A comparison of heuristics for energy-aware resource allocation
    • Henry Hoffmann. Racing vs. pacing to idle: A comparison of heuristics for energy-aware resource allocation. In HotPower, 2013.
    • (2013) HotPower
    • Hoffmann, H.1
  • 22
    • 77954728886 scopus 로고    scopus 로고
    • Application heartbeats: A generic interface for specifying program performance and goals in autonomous computing environments
    • Henry Hoffmann, Jonathan Eastep, Marco D. Santambrogio, Jason E. Miller, and Anant Agarwal. Application heartbeats: a generic interface for specifying program performance and goals in autonomous computing environments. In ICAC, 2010.
    • (2010) ICAC
    • Hoffmann, H.1    Eastep, J.2    Santambrogio, M.D.3    Miller, J.E.4    Agarwal, A.5
  • 24
    • 84892654929 scopus 로고    scopus 로고
    • A generalized software framework for accurate and efficient managment of performance goals
    • Henry Hoffmann, Martina Maggio, Marco D. Santambrogio, Alberto Leva, and Anant Agarwal. A generalized software framework for accurate and efficient managment of performance goals. In EMSOFT, 2013.
    • (2013) EMSOFT
    • Hoffmann, H.1    Maggio, M.2    Santambrogio, M.D.3    Leva, A.4    Agarwal, A.5
  • 26
    • 34047123131 scopus 로고    scopus 로고
    • Dynamic voltage scaling in multitier web servers with end-to-end delay control
    • IEEE Transactions on
    • T. Horvath, T. Abdelzaher, K. Skadron, and Xue Liu. Dynamic voltage scaling in multitier web servers with end-to-end delay control. Computers, IEEE Transactions on, 56(4), 2007.
    • (2007) Computers , vol.56 , Issue.4
    • Horvath, T.1    Abdelzaher, T.2    Skadron, K.3    Liu, X.4
  • 27
    • 84944682421 scopus 로고    scopus 로고
    • Poet: A portable approach to minimizing energy under soft real-time constraints
    • Connor Imes, David H. K. Kim, Martina Maggio, and Henry Hoffmann. Poet: A portable approach to minimizing energy under soft real-time constraints. In RTAS, 2015.
    • (2015) RTAS
    • Imes, C.1    Kim, D.H.K.2    Maggio, M.3    Hoffmann, H.4
  • 28
    • 52649148744 scopus 로고    scopus 로고
    • Self-optimizing memory controllers: A reinforcement learning approach
    • Engin Ipek, Onur Mutlu, José F. Martínez, and Rich Caruana. Self-optimizing memory controllers: A reinforcement learning approach. In ISCA, 2008.
    • (2008) ISCA
    • Ipek, E.1    Mutlu, O.2    Martínez, J.F.3    Caruana, R.4
  • 29
    • 33244491689 scopus 로고    scopus 로고
    • Research challenges of autonomic computing
    • J.O. Kephart. Research challenges of autonomic computing. In ICSE, 2005.
    • (2005) ICSE
    • Kephart, J.O.1
  • 31
    • 84939149471 scopus 로고    scopus 로고
    • Guest editor's introduction: Creating robust software through self-adaptation
    • Robert Laddaga. Guest editor's introduction: Creating robust software through self-adaptation. IEEE Intelligent Systems, 14, 1999.
    • (1999) IEEE Intelligent Systems , vol.14
    • Laddaga, R.1
  • 33
    • 66749185800 scopus 로고    scopus 로고
    • Cpr: Composable performance regression for scalable multiprocessor models
    • B.C. Lee, J. Collins, Hong Wang, and D. Brooks. Cpr: Composable performance regression for scalable multiprocessor models. In MICRO, 2008.
    • (2008) MICRO
    • Lee, B.C.1    Collins, J.2    Wang, H.3    Brooks, D.4
  • 34
    • 62349137924 scopus 로고    scopus 로고
    • Efficiency trends and limits from comprehensive microarchitectural adaptivity
    • Benjamin C. Lee and David Brooks. Efficiency trends and limits from comprehensive microarchitectural adaptivity. In ASPLOS, 2008.
    • (2008) ASPLOS
    • Lee, B.C.1    Brooks, D.2
  • 35
    • 34547288276 scopus 로고    scopus 로고
    • Accurate and efficient regression modeling for microarchitectural performance and power prediction
    • Benjamin C. Lee and David M. Brooks. Accurate and efficient regression modeling for microarchitectural performance and power prediction. In ASPLOS, 2006.
    • (2006) ASPLOS
    • Lee, B.C.1    Brooks, D.M.2
  • 36
    • 0001263652 scopus 로고    scopus 로고
    • A control-based middleware framework for quality-of-service adaptations
    • Baochun Li and K. Nahrstedt. A control-based middleware framework for quality-of-service adaptations. IEEE Journal on Selected Areas in Communications, 17(9), 1999.
    • (1999) IEEE Journal on Selected Areas in Communications , vol.17 , Issue.9
    • Li, B.1    Nahrstedt, K.2
  • 37
    • 33748879741 scopus 로고    scopus 로고
    • Dynamic power-performance adaptation of parallel computation on chip multiprocessors
    • J. Li and J.F. Martinez. Dynamic power-performance adaptation of parallel computation on chip multiprocessors. In HPCA, 2006.
    • (2006) HPCA
    • Li, J.1    Martinez, J.F.2
  • 38
    • 33747604376 scopus 로고    scopus 로고
    • Feedback control architecture and design methodology for service delay guarantees in web servers
    • September
    • C. Lu, Y. Lu, T.F. Abdelzaher, J.A. Stankovic, and S.H. Son. Feedback control architecture and design methodology for service delay guarantees in web servers. IEEE TPDS, 17(9):1014-1027, September 2006.
    • (2006) IEEE TPDS , vol.17 , Issue.9 , pp. 1014-1027
    • Lu, C.1    Lu, Y.2    Abdelzaher, T.F.3    Stankovic, J.A.4    Son, S.H.5
  • 42
    • 84950432453 scopus 로고
    • Parametric empirical bayes inference: Theory and applications
    • Carl N Morris. Parametric empirical bayes inference: theory and applications. Journal of the American Statistical Association, 78(381):47-55, 1983.
    • (1983) Journal of the American Statistical Association , vol.78 , Issue.381 , pp. 47-55
    • Morris, C.N.1
  • 44
    • 84881155497 scopus 로고    scopus 로고
    • Flicker: A dynamically adaptive architecture for power limited multicore systems
    • Paula Petrica, Adam M. Izraelevitz, David H. Albonesi, and Christine A. Shoemaker. Flicker: A dynamically adaptive architecture for power limited multicore systems. In ISCA, 2013.
    • (2013) ISCA
    • Petrica, P.1    Izraelevitz, A.M.2    Albonesi, D.H.3    Shoemaker, C.A.4
  • 45
    • 0035691607 scopus 로고    scopus 로고
    • Reducing power requirements of instruction scheduling through dynamic allocation of multiple datapath resources
    • Dmitry Ponomarev, Gurhan Kucuk, and Kanad Ghose. Reducing power requirements of instruction scheduling through dynamic allocation of multiple datapath resources. In MICRO, 2001.
    • (2001) MICRO
    • Ponomarev, D.1    Kucuk, G.2    Ghose, K.3
  • 46
    • 60549116732 scopus 로고    scopus 로고
    • No "power" struggles: Coordinated multi-level power management for the data center
    • R. Raghavendra, P. Ranganathan, V Talwar, Z. Wang, and X. Zhu. No "power" struggles: coordinated multi-level power management for the data center. In ASPLOS, 2008.
    • (2008) ASPLOS
    • Raghavendra, R.1    Ranganathan, P.2    Talwar, V.3    Wang, Z.4    Zhu, X.5
  • 49
    • 70349742463 scopus 로고    scopus 로고
    • Self-adaptive software: Landscape and research challenges
    • Mazeiar Salehie and Ladan Tahvildari. Self-adaptive software: Landscape and research challenges. ACM Trans. Auton. Adapt. Syst., 4(2):1-42, 2009.
    • (2009) ACM Trans. Auton. Adapt. Syst. , vol.4 , Issue.2 , pp. 1-42
    • Salehie, M.1    Tahvildari, L.2
  • 52
    • 84879814702 scopus 로고    scopus 로고
    • Holistic run-time parallelism management for time and energy efficiency
    • Srinath Sridharan, Gagan Gupta, and Gurindar S. Sohi. Holistic run-time parallelism management for time and energy efficiency. In ICS, 2013.
    • (2013) ICS
    • Sridharan, S.1    Gupta, G.2    Sohi, G.S.3
  • 53
    • 79951501560 scopus 로고    scopus 로고
    • LPV model and its application in web server performance control
    • Q. Sun, G. Dai, and W. Pan. LPV model and its application in web server performance control. In ICCSSE, 2008.
    • (2008) ICCSSE
    • Sun, Q.1    Dai, G.2    Pan, W.3
  • 54
    • 69249231088 scopus 로고    scopus 로고
    • Grace-2: Integrating finegrained application adaptation with global adaptation for saving energy
    • Vibhore Vardhan, Wanghong Yuan, Albert F. Harris III, Sarita V. Adve, Robin Kravets, Klara Nahrstedt, Daniel Grobe Sachs, and Douglas L. Jones. Grace-2: integrating finegrained application adaptation with global adaptation for saving energy. IJES, 4(2), 2009.
    • (2009) IJES , vol.4 , Issue.2
    • Vardhan, V.1    Yuan, W.2    Harris, A.F.3    Adve, S.V.4    Kravets, R.5    Nahrstedt, K.6    Sachs, D.G.7    Jones, D.L.8
  • 55
    • 78149278347 scopus 로고    scopus 로고
    • Scalable thread scheduling and global power management for heterogeneous many-core architectures
    • Jonathan A. Winter, David H. Albonesi, and Christine A. Shoemaker. Scalable thread scheduling and global power management for heterogeneous many-core architectures. In PACT, 2010.
    • (2010) PACT
    • Winter, J.A.1    Albonesi, D.H.2    Shoemaker, C.A.3
  • 56
    • 0002210265 scopus 로고
    • On the convergence properties of the em algorithm
    • CF Jeff Wu. On the convergence properties of the em algorithm. The Annals of statistics, pages 95-103, 1983.
    • (1983) The Annals of Statistics , pp. 95-103
    • Jeff Wu, C.F.1
  • 57
    • 12844283854 scopus 로고    scopus 로고
    • Formal online methods for voltage/frequency control in multiple clock domain microprocessors
    • Qiang Wu, Philo Juang, Margaret Martonosi, and Douglas W. Clark. Formal online methods for voltage/frequency control in multiple clock domain microprocessors. In ASPLOS, 2004.
    • (2004) ASPLOS
    • Wu, Q.1    Juang, P.2    Martonosi, M.3    Clark, D.W.4
  • 58
    • 84876529275 scopus 로고    scopus 로고
    • Inferred models for dynamic and sparse hardware-software spaces
    • 2012 45th Annual IEEE/ACM International Symposium on IEEE
    • Weidan Wu and Benjamin C Lee. Inferred models for dynamic and sparse hardware-software spaces. In Microarchitecture (MICRO), 2012 45th Annual IEEE/ACM International Symposium on, pages 413-424. IEEE, 2012.
    • (2012) Microarchitecture (MICRO) , pp. 413-424
    • Wu, W.1    Lee, B.C.2
  • 59
    • 33749057743 scopus 로고    scopus 로고
    • A statistically rigorous approach for improving simulation methodology
    • Joshua J. Yi, David J. Lilja, and Douglas M. Hawkins. A statistically rigorous approach for improving simulation methodology. In HPCA, 2003.
    • (2003) HPCA
    • Yi, J.J.1    Lilja, D.J.2    Hawkins, D.M.3
  • 61
    • 0036367561 scopus 로고    scopus 로고
    • Controlware: A middleware architecture for feedback control of software performance
    • R. Zhang, C. Lu, T.F. Abdelzaher, and J.A. Stankovic. Controlware: A middleware architecture for feedback control of software performance. In ICDCS, 2002.
    • (2002) ICDCS
    • Zhang, R.1    Lu, C.2    Abdelzaher, T.F.3    Stankovic, J.A.4
  • 62
    • 84871107013 scopus 로고    scopus 로고
    • A flexible framework for throttling-enabled multicore management (temm)
    • Xiao Zhang, Rongrong Zhong, Sandhya Dwarkadas, and Kai Shen. A flexible framework for throttling-enabled multicore management (temm). In ICPP, 2012.
    • (2012) ICPP
    • Zhang, X.1    Zhong, R.2    Dwarkadas, S.3    Shen, K.4


* 이 정보는 Elsevier사의 SCOPUS DB에서 KISTI가 분석하여 추출한 것입니다.